Industrial Automation Engineer - Pharmaceutical Manufacturing
Job Description
Job Description
Description:
We are seeking a highly skilled and experienced Industrial Automation Engineer - Pharmaceutical Manufacturing to join our pharmaceutical manufacturing plant and help create the future of how medicines are made and accomplish a mission to help brilliant minds bring medicines to life through advanced development and manufacturing in America.
The ideal candidate will be responsible for the maintenance, repair, and troubleshooting of all automation systems and process controls to ensure optimal production efficiency and compliance with safety and regulatory standards. This role requires a deep understanding of pharmaceutical manufacturing processes, equipment, and GMP (Good Manufacturing Practices) regulations. Requirements:- Automation & Controls : Deep understanding of Distributed Control Systems (DCS). Able to assist with daily operational issues as well as long-term projects. Make programming edits, save backups, troubleshoot faults and alarms, add I/O points, and more. Able to work on low voltage controls circuits and controllers’ hands on. Routinely use electrical tools to troubleshoot systems. Able to program Variable Frequency Drives (VFD) parameters. Able to tune feedback loops and PID loops.
- Troubleshooting & Repair: Diagnose, troubleshoot, and solve control system issues on both process and building systems/equipment. This includes identifying the root cause of failures and implementing corrective actions to minimize downtime.
- Preventive Maintenance: Perform scheduled preventive maintenance on all automation systems including production machines, HVAC systems, and logic controllers, to ensure they operate efficiently and effectively.
- Calibrations : Oversee all process instrumentation calibrations. Responsible for on time completion of all calibrations and GMP appropriate record keeping. Address and complete root cause analysis for all non-conformances.
- Equipment Installation: Assist in the installation, commissioning, and calibration of new equipment. Ensure that all installations comply with industry standards and regulatory requirements.
- Documentation & Compliance: Maintain accurate records of maintenance activities. Ensure all work is performed in compliance with GMP, OSHA, and other relevant safety and regulatory standards.
- Collaboration: Work closely with other departments, such as production, quality assurance, and engineering, to coordinate maintenance activities and minimize disruption to production schedules. Role will collaborate closely with site IT department to ensure that systems remain secure and user permissions are managed.
- Continuous Improvement: Identify opportunities for process improvement and recommend enhancements to equipment and maintenance procedures to increase efficiency, reduce costs, and improve safety.
- Contractor Oversight: Work with external contractors as needed to complete projects and repairs on equipment.
- Vendor Engagement: Work with outside vendors to secure spare parts and alternative options/materials as results of root cause analysis and continuous improvement.
- Safety: Follow and enforce all safety protocols, including Lockout/Tagout (LOTO) procedures, and ensure a safe working environment for all personnel.
